Idea for naval strategy
Never mind. Don’t bother reading ied this yet so I would like to spare the “well you must have versed lousy players for that work comments”. This could work for either japan or the us but probably better for the us. This strategy would work best when your fleet is parked at a naval base and airfield island. You move your fleet to the sea zone and your consists of 3 or 4 submarines a number of carriers and a number of destroyers ( numbers not really important as long as your navy is a pretty comperable to enemy navy). You land all of your aircraft on the island and take advantage of the airfield. Then you position a submarine between your fleet and the enemys fleet to block a destroyer. Imy is at a navy base position two submarines one in each seazone the enemy needs to move through to attack your fleet. Now if the enemy attacks your fleet he won’t be able to bring his destroyers with him to defend against surprise strikes. That gives you 6 or 8 rolls at a one for defense for every round of combat. ( surprise strike and main strike). That will quickly kill most of his surface fleet. Then if he plans on an invasion don’t scramble the fighters and use them for defense (make this known as soon as he says he will amphib assualt). He will then need his fighters for the land combat. That will force him to bring his carriers into your seazone on his noncombat move if he came from a naval base. Save the subs by submerging them if it looks like you are going to lose the sea battle (which I really don’t sea happening). Then because of your two subs that will block him from moving a destroyer into your seazone (in most cases) you can use the subs to kill any thing left on your turn. But if his carriers survive in on of the adjacent seazone with planes(he didn’t attack the island) you send in your subs and planes and either kill all of his aircraft and kill the carrier (a little luck needed) or you damage the carrier and destroy all of the planes since They would have no where to land. Then if the us is using this strat have Anzac finish the carriers off.

Air unit carrier landing clarification
I am currently in the middle of a game and we have run into a little discrepency. The UK fleet is parked in seazone 4 (the one next to germany) and the german player has just built a carrier on his turn. He did this thinking he could land air units on it. I feel as though he can’t land that planes because they move on the noncombat movement and the carrier is built in the purchase units. Since they move on the noncombat move phase they cannot enter and land in a hostile sea zone. My opponet disagress saying this is no different than any other time a carrier is built and planes move to that seazone to land on it (in same turn.)
